Today, its phase is a constant quit for modern-day entertainers like and, however the organization maintains a long and colorful background. Its beginnings can be traced back to 1917 when Portland homeowners opened up the city's very first publicly-owned setting up center. As the requirement for space grew, a second area was opened, which was at some point called the Paramount Theatre.


Portland Oregon Metropolitan AreaPortland Oregon Time To Philippine Time
The people of Portland fought so hard against the decision that in 1972, the Rose city City Council declared the Paramount a historical spots. Twitter/ @reallychannel In enhancement to dining establishments, art galleries, and retail stores, Rose city is additionally home to a collection of passages that attach the cellars of the city's oldest structures to the Willamette River and Rose city's Chinatown.


History publications have actually subjected more sinister tasks that took area. While Rose city wasn't recognized as a large city during this time, it did have a large port that could sustain a good number of ships.


Usually, that involved situating young, able-bodied people, obtaining them drunk, and enticing them into the tunnels. There, they would be knocked subconscious and offered into labor. Today, strolling tours are readily available to those who intend to find out more regarding the passages and their history. The location has also come to be a popular location for ghost tours looking for one of the most "haunted" components of Rose city.
